How Our Crawl Space Water Extraction Service Works
Our team will arrive at your property within 60 minutes, equipped with the latest technology to extract the water and dry the area. We’ll begin by assessing the damage and identifying the source of the water. Our technicians will then use specialized equipment to extract the water, including our powerful pumps and wet vacuums.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We’ll assess the damage and identify the source of the water. Our technicians will then contain the area to prevent further damage and ensure your safety.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use our powerful pumps and wet vacuums to extract the water from your crawlspace. This step is crucial to preventing further damage and ensuring your property is safe.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use our state-of-the-art drying equipment to remove any remaining moisture from your crawlspace. This step is critical to preventing mold and mildew growth.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
We’ll use our specialized equipment to sanitize and disinfect your crawlspace, ensuring it’s safe for you and your family to occupy.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Repair
We’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ure your crawlspace is completely dry and safe. Our technicians will also identify any necessary repairs and provide you with a detailed estimate.

Crawl Space Water Extraction Cost In Fayetteville, GA
The cost of crawl space water extraction in Fayetteville, GA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ate after assessing the damage and identifying the source of the water.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$200 – $1,000 | Severity of damage and size of affected area |
| Water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and amount of water extracted |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and level of moisture |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and level of contamination |
| Final Inspection and Repair |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age and size of affected area |
